The role of ABC and vacuole transporters in plants

Molecular Physiology

Using modern molecular, biochemical and electrophysiological approaches as well as classical physiology our laboratory aims to elucidate different aspects of plant physiology. In our group the elucidation of the role of transporters is the major topic. Using the model plant Arabidopsis, we are investigating the role of ABC transporters in heavy metal resistance, stomata regulation and auxin transport. Another focus is the elucidation of the role of vacuolar transporters in maintaining the cytosolic homeostasis for metabolites and inorganic ions.
